Brief Explanations:

  • "Let's try thinking about it another way" encourages considering different viewpoints, which is relevant when not all perspectives are heard.
  • "Everyone's saying the same thing" just states a fact about uniformity of statements, not directly addressing unheard perspectives.
  • "Nobody's listening to me" focuses on one's own lack of being heard, not all perspectives.
  • "There's only one right answer" implies a narrow view, not related to hearing all perspectives.

Answer:

"Let's try thinking about it another way."
